Continue is an open-source IDE extension that adds AI chat, autocomplete, and editing to VS Code and JetBrains. Connect any LLM — local or cloud. Customizable with your own prompts and context.

Warp is a GPU-accelerated terminal with built-in AI. Features include natural language command generation, AI-powered error correction, collaborative workflows, and a modern block-based UI. Runs on macOS and Linux.
